Pepo was rescued by Animal Angels Global from the streets of Spain, where he was found begging for scraps from passersby. Once they got him off the streets, he was taken to the UK to find his forever home.
Sadly, finding him a forever home wasn't as easy as it seemed.
With his severe underbite that caused several of his bottom teeth to stick out, a crooked nose, and out-turned feet, the poor thing was rejected again and again because of his appearance.

He ended up staying at his foster home for eight months while they continued posting about him on social media, trying to find a home for him. Since no one was coming forward, his rescuers decided to change tactics and started posting captions from Pepo's perspective.
“I have been looking for a new family for a long time now, and I’m wondering if nobody wants me because of my teeth,” one post read.
Just like a charm, it worked. Their posts about Pepo started touching more people's hearts, and that's when it caught the attention of a woman from Tiverton, England.

When Jo Strachan's sister tagged her in one of the Pepo posts, Jo immediately fell in love with Pepo's unique face. She and her husband, Glen, had also been looking for another dog to keep their dog Bob company since he had just lost his sibling a few months earlier.
So, Jo immediately set out to fill out an application, and after carefully reviewing it, the rescue decided she was just the person to take care of Pepo.
When they got Pepo home, Jo discovered that the pooch ran like a newborn lamb or foal. Apparently, it's because of the carpal valgus in his front legs, which prevents him from coordinating his feet like normal dogs would.

In addition to that, X-rays and scans revealed evidence of fractures and broken bones. This led Pepo's vets to believe that the pooch, who is around two years old, was severely abused when he was a puppy.
Despite that, the pup continued to show so much love and affection for humans. He didn't lose faith in humanity.
And despite his wonky looks and legs, he acts just like any other dog that loves playing and running around.
Jo says he's also very loving and always shows his gratitude to his new family. She even says that he immediately snuggled up to her within hours of adopting him and bringing him home.
“He really is just one of those animals where you think, how can he have been so mistreated and still want human company and trust?” Jo told DailyMail. “It’s just amazing.”
